This community is best suited for families who want compassionate, non-medical in-home care that enables a loved one to remain in familiar surroundings. Sun Lakes’ Home Instead excels for seniors who prioritize staying at home, appreciate a clearly explained range of services, and value a company with a long-standing track record. The reviews repeatedly highlight reliable caregivers, punctual visits, and a personality-driven approach that makes daily routines safer and more comfortable. For families seeking reassurance about the caregiver team and the continuity of care, this option stands out.

Those considering alternatives should note that Home Instead Sun Lakes may not be the right fit for every situation. If a loved one requires intensive medical oversight, skilled nursing, or a highly structured memory-care program, an assisted living community or a residential care setting may be more appropriate. Similarly, for households needing 24/7 supervision or flexible, around-the-clock medical attention, an alternative model should be explored. Budget realities and the desire for a certain level of on-site clinical support can also push families toward facility-based options rather than purely in-home services.

The main drawbacks are not dramatic, but they matter in decision-making. This model centers on non-medical assistance, so complex medical tasks, acute monitoring, or memory-care-specific programming will require a different arrangement. Dependence on the caregiver network means families should verify hours, back-up coverage, and match quality; gaps or turnover can introduce risk if not managed carefully. Also, cost considerations, while not explicitly detailed in the reviews, are inherent to in-home services and can influence the decision between enhanced at-home care and transitioning to a facility with bundled services.

    Palliative care focuses on alleviating distress at any stage of a serious illness and can accompany curative treatments, while hospice care is for those nearing the end of life with a prognosis of six months or less, emphasizing comfort over curative measures. Both prioritize holistic care for patients and families but differ in timing, goals, and scope.
